HDMI:高清多媒体接口
介绍
高清多媒体接口 (HDMI) 是最流行的音频/视频接口之一,用于传输支持 HDMI 的来源的数字音频和视频。显示控制器、兼容的计算机显示器、视频投影仪、数字电视和数字音频设备都是这些设备的一些示例。HDMI 已取代模拟视频标准,成为数字标准。电视、电脑显示器、家庭娱乐系统、视频显示器以及许多其他视听设备都使用 HDMI 接口。由于 HDMI 接口的性能,该系统适合家庭影院、视频和电视系统中组件之间现在必须交换的超高数据速率。
历史
二十年前,有很多竞争接口用于在音频和视频设备之间发送视频和声音。这导致消费者和专业人士都面临各种问题。技术的进步构成了最大的障碍。电视广播公司、计算机和音频视频设备制造商以及其他公司看到了高清视频的潜力。问题不在于这种高质量图像的创建或传输,而在于它们在消费者屏幕上的接收和显示。具体来说,是接收器、录像机、电视、计算机和显示器等各种设备之间的信号传输。

规格
通过 HDMI® 协议(一种用于连接各种设备的连接机制),未压缩的音频和视频被组合成单个数字接口。它支持多达 8 个通道的数字音频以及高清和标清视频。
HDMI 的优点
更高的质量 - HDMI 提供无损传输和在更高分辨率和低光照场景下更好的视频。
深色 - HDMI 提供 10 位、12 位和 16 位的色深 (RGB 或 YCbCr)。
高清信号在传输过程中不会被压缩,因此不会出现信号质量下降。
设备被授权接收 HDMI 支持的来源发送的加密内容。他们确保没有人可以访问内容以从事盗版活动。
通信通道协议
HDMI 上有三个物理上不同的通信通道:DDC、TMDS 和可选的 CEC。
DDC(显示数据通道)
一组称为显示数据通道 (DDC) 的协议允许计算机显示器和图形卡进行数字通信,这允许计算机主机更改显示器设置(如亮度和对比度),并允许显示器将支持的显示模式传达给适配器。
DDC 引脚存在于 DVI 和 DisplayPort 连接器上,就像它们存在于现代模拟 VGA 连接器上一样,尽管 DisplayPort 仅在 DVI/HDMI 模式下使用其可选的双模式 DP (DP++) 功能时才支持 DDC。该标准由视频电子标准协会 (VESA) 制定。
TMDS(最小化转换差分信号)
可以使用称为“最小化转换差分信号”(TMDS) 的技术传输高速串行数据以及其他数字通信接口,例如 HDMI 视频接口。发射机使用复杂的编码方案来减少铜缆上的电磁干扰,并允许接收机可靠地恢复时钟以实现高偏斜容限,从而驱动更长和更短、成本更低的电线。
CEC(消费电子控制)
HDMI 的一个组件,即消费电子控制 (CEC),允许用户使用单个遥控器控制所有连接到 HDMI 的设备。因此,最多 15 个支持 CEC 的设备可以相互通信并相互控制,而无需用户干预。例如,电视的遥控器也可以操作机顶盒和 DVD 播放器。
应用
高清 DVD 和蓝光播放器
2006 年推出的蓝光光盘和高清 DVD 提供高保真音频功能,需要 HDMI 才能获得最佳性能。
数码相机或摄像机
大多数消费级摄像机和许多数码相机都配有 mini-HDMI 接口。
个人电脑
具有 DVI 接口的个人电脑 (PC) 可以将视频输出到支持 HDMI 的显示器。根据硬件的不同,某些 PC 具有 HDMI 接口,并且还可以广播 HDMI 音频。
结论
高清多媒体接口 (HDMI) 是最流行的音频/视频接口之一,用于传输支持 HDMI 的来源的数字音频和视频。电视、电脑显示器、家庭娱乐系统、视频显示器以及许多其他视听设备都使用 HDMI 接口。HDMI 是一种用于连接各种设备的连接机制。它支持多达 8 个通道的数字音频以及高清和标清视频。DisplayPort 仅在 DVI/HDMI 模式下使用其可选的双模式 DP (DP++) 功能时才支持 DDC。
常见问题
Q1. 确保您的设备具有相同的 HDMI 版本是否至关重要?
答:是的,因为 HDMI 版本是“向下兼容”的,因此输出 HDMI 1.3 的设备通常会将数据正确发送到接受 HDMI 1.4 的输入。建议除了版本号之外,还要检查版本支持的功能,并确认系统中的每个设备和电缆都支持您所需的功能。
Q2. 所有 HDMI 连接是否都以相同的方式广播全高清 1080p 和深色?
答:HDMI 认证共有五种,其中最流行的两种是:
标准 HDMI 支持 720p/1080i 传输,速度高达 2.25Gbps。高速 HDMI 支持高清 1080p 和深色等功能,速度高达 10.2Gbps。
Q3. 我可以可靠地在长距离上运行 HDMI 吗?
答:HDMI 电缆在其原始设计中在对抗长电缆运行中信号丢失问题方面并不比 DVI 或 VGA 更有效。大多数长度超过 5 到 10 米的电缆都会在从源到输出的传输过程中丢失数据。
数据结构
网络
RDBMS
操作系统
Java
iOS
HTML
CSS
Android
Python
C语言编程
C++
C#
MongoDB
MySQL
Javascript
PHP